Default twin turbo or not ?

What do you think guys, should i get the twin scroll convertion done and then get the twin scroll billet turbo from scooby clinic or get the bolt on sc42/sc46 billet turbo? all i want is sooner spool,i am not after chaseing numbers because i know the twin is limit on bhp.well it all started after being in a mate hawkeye, even though the bhp was less then my scooby it seem alot faster with constant boost ! and i though i want this lol , i dont want to end up spending £1,500 to get the sc42/sc46 and still have the lag till 3+rpm and wish i have done the convertion.

quite a bit of money to convert to twinscroll then buy a twinscroll billet turbo, looking at 2.5k plus.

for that you could buy a single scroll billet turbo, new headers with a matched up pipe and get much better spool.
